The firestarter RPM cause selinux errors on shutdown and other errors on 
startup.  These errors have ben tracked down to the line "sh 
/etc/firestarter/firestarter.sh start" which
starts firestarter independent of the firestater init script.  Removing 
this line solves the selinux errors and the firewall policy still seems 
to be in effect.  I am theroizing that the line above is executed when 
the dhclient daemon attempts to shutdown  as well as start thus 
attempting to start the firewall while closing the interface.  I think 
this is what selinux is flagging.  The line also causes some errors on 
interface startup.  Does this line have a useful purpose?
